Navigating Economic Sentiments

This chapter examines the mixed reactions to recent job numbers, highlighting optimism about low unemployment contrasted with inflation fears. It explores the administration’s efforts to manage public expectations and addresses the disconnect between economic realities and consumer perceptions.
